Seha has reduced the cost of nasal swab test to Dh65
Dubai: In a circular issued by Abu Dhabi Health Services Company (Seha) on March 23, the cost of Polymerase Chain Reaction (PCR) nasal swab test for COVID-19 to Dh65.
Earlier, the cost of the test was Dh85.
Seha, which operates testing centres across the UAE, also has the option for certain categories to get tested for free. So, if you wish to take the PCR test from a Seha screening centre, here is all you need to know about how to book and where to go.
The following priority categories are eligible for free testing.
• UAE nationals
• Senior citizens above 50 years old
• Residents above 50 years old
• People suffering from chronic disease
If you fall under any of the above categories, you can book a free COVID-19 test by calling the authority’s COVID-19 hotline on 8001717.
Otherwise free testing is available by booking an appointment through the SEHA App for the following categories.
• UAE nationals
• Children of Emirati women
• Domestic workers working in Emirati Households
• People suffering from chronic diseases
• Residents above 50 years old
• People of determination
• Pregnant women
Note: You can avail a free screening only once every four months.
